Hole Description
Two pins on every green provide a unique design variation on Renegade; one flagstick is usually set forward in a relatively easy position, the other is more challenging. Golfers have the option of choosing from the different pin positions to vary the difficulty of the hole - no other course in the world offers this feature. The first of the Nicklaus courses to open at Desert Mountain, Renegade has entertained members since 1986, earning a place on Golf Digest’s “America’s 100 Greatest Golf Courses” list three times, and the magazine’s singular description as “the most versatile course in the world.”
